The correct answer here is Option C) - 'Had already left'. This is because this phrase satisfies the rules of proper grammatical convention the best and follows the tense of the sentence as well (in this case, primarily past perfect). The answer is had already left as the past perfect is used to refer to an action that has finished before another action in the past; in this case when Girijia arrived, Usha had already left.
